"I lived here for a year. This is a perfectly acceptable place to live! However with the rise of rent rates I’m not sure if it’s worth the price... I paid $905 for a two bedroom, which they recently raised to $1035, which is part of why I moved out. The kitchen was very dark, needed some lighting above the sink. Kitchen sink and faucet could use an upgrade, especially since it didn’t have a dishwasher. No microwave either, and virtually no counter space. Not the most pleasant space. You need some sort of secondary counter space like a utility cart to make it work well. The rest of the apartment was fine, had two ceiling fans, one in a bedroom which was a plus. My heat broke down twice during the year... but the in-building land lady was helpful both times and it was fixed either same day or the next day. The building itself is kind of smelly, seems like a mix of smoke and animal smell. I had to use air fresheners constantly to keep my apartment from smelling like that. The location is very nice, relatively family friendly. The YMCA and park are right next door. Each apartment has a screened in balcony, which is very cool! It’s clear the screens were not installed professionally, someone with some screens and a staple gun clearly made them. Not perfect, but they work well enough! All in all a fine place to live if the rent rates make sense for you! I enjoyed my time there."
